Real Madrid and Barcelona interested in Kai Havertz

Real Madrid have reportedly joined Barcelona in the race to sign Bayer Leverkusen star Kai Havertz.

Ernesto Valverde's side were linked with a move for the German international over the summer, however they opted against a deal after bringing in Antoine Griezmann and Frenkie De Jong.

The 20-year old has come through the youth ranks at the Bundesliga side, and established himself as a regular in the last two seasons, as a key figure in their midfield.

According to reports in Marca, Barcelona are still interested in a potential deal, but Real Madrid have also registered an interest, as part of their pursuit of the best young players from across Europe.

The main barrier for a move to one of La Liga's big guns appears to be a potential move to Bundesliga giants Bayern Munich – who  have also scouted Havertz in the past 12 months.

Club director Rudi Voller admitted that Bayern were not the only side interested in their star player, and hinted that it would take a bid in the region of €100M to take him away from the club.
